Skating on ice for winter

Staff ReporterEastern Reporter

Event organisers Big Bang Productions are creating Winterland, Perth’s first inner city outdoor ice-skating rink, from July 4-20.

The 250sq m ice rink will be complemented by a winter themed bar and caf� and food stalls. MRA chief executive Kieran Kinsella said the total sponsorship of the event from MRA was estimated to be more than $40,000.

‘The MRA continues to sponsor a regular program of events (such as Winterland), festivals and art commissions to ensure the area remains ‘alive’,’ he said.
